Как организованы механизмы обработки событий в текущем времени
Механизмы обработки происшествий в реальном времени составляют собой совокупность софтверных компонентов, которые получают, анализируют и преобразуют потоки данных с наименьшей задержкой. Такие платформы функционируют непрерывно, гарантируя моментальную ответ на приходящую данные.
Фундамент построения формируют три ключевых элемента: источники инцидентов, обработчики и репозитории данных. Источники формируют непрестанный поток данных через особые соединения. Обработчики выполняют отбор, преобразование и суммирование данных согласно заданным принципам.
Актуальные решения используют распределённую структуру для достижения высокой эффективности. Поступающие происшествия распределяются между совокупностью компонентов обработки, что позволяет 1 xbet увеличиваться горизонтально и обслуживать миллионы происшествий в секунду.
Критическим параметром выступает время реакции — период между принятием инцидента и формированием ответа. Надежные платформы преобразуют информацию за миллисекунды, что важно для экономических транзакций и механизмов охраны.
Источники происшествий: датчики, программы, логи, операции и пользовательские действия
Происшествия приходят в комплекс из многообразных источников, каждый из которых генерирует уникальный тип данных. Сенсоры промышленного техники отправляют данные температуры, давления, вибрации и прочих физических величин с частотой до сотен замеров в секунду.
Веб-приложения и мобильные службы производят события при работе пользователя с оболочкой. Щелчки, просмотры страниц, внесение продуктов создают беспрерывный последовательность деятельности. Серверные сервисы регистрируют запросы к API и модификации статуса подключений.
Системные логи записывают технические происшествия: сбои, предостережения, информационные оповещения о функционировании инфраструктуры. Выделенные службы получают записи с серверов и контейнеров, пересылая их в 1xbet казино для консолидированной обработки.
Финансовые переводы создают критически важные происшествия при переводах и платежах. Банковские системы производят сведения о каждой операции с картой и модификации остатка. Торговые решения фиксируют ордера на закупку и реализацию активов.
Архитектура непрерывной обслуживания
Поточная преобразование основывается на принципе постоянного движения данных через череду процессоров без переходного записи. Инциденты движутся через цепочку модификаций, где каждый модуль производит конкретную задачу: селекцию, расширение, объединение или маршрутизацию.
Базовая архитектура охватывает слой получения данных, который принимает происшествия из сторонних источников и конвертирует их в единообразный вид. Очередной слой производит бизнес-логику: рассчитывает параметры, выявляет нарушения, использует правила обработки. Результаты отправляются в уровень экспорта для записи или отправки.
Актуальные решения поддерживают два подхода к обработке. Первый обрабатывает каждое событие самостоятельно тотчас после принятия. Второй формирует инциденты в минипакеты и обрабатывает их с промежутком в несколько секунд. Решение зависит от запросов к отсрочке и объёму данных.
Компоненты структуры сотрудничают через унифицированные интерфейсы, что позволяет менять конкретные компоненты без изменения целой структуры. 1хбет казино обеспечивает пластичность при модификации требований.
Очереди и магистрали данных: как события передаются между модулями
Пересылка инцидентов между модулями платформы производится через особые инструменты передачи сообщениями. Очереди уведомлений предоставляют надёжную транспортировку данных от источников к получателям с обеспечением безопасности при отказах.
Шины данных составляют собой распределенные системы для публикации и получения на потоки инцидентов. Производители направляют сообщения в названные очереди, а адресаты подписываются на необходимые разделы. Такая подход позволяет отдельному происшествию охватывать множества потребителей одновременно.
Ключевые параметры механизмов отправки происшествий охватывают:
- Пропускную способность — количество уведомлений в отрезок времени
- Задержку транспортировки — время между отсылкой и получением
- Гарантирования транспортировки — показатель стабильности транспортировки
- Упорядоченность — сохранение очередности событий
Механизмы кэширования сохраняют события при преходящей недоступности получателей. 1xbet казино записывает уведомления на диске до момента удачной обработки. Репликация между серверами предупреждает утрату сведений при отказе серверов.
Варианты обработки
Комплексы реального времени используют многообразные схемы обработки событий в связи от бизнес-требований и специфики данных. Каждая схема задает способ группировки, исследования и преобразования входящих потоков.
Преобразование конкретных инцидентов рассматривает каждое сообщение автономно от прочих. Механизм применяет правила отбора и дополнения к каждой записи сразу после принятия. Такой метод сокращает латентности и применим для критичных случаев с необходимостью немедленной ответа.
Оконная преобразование собирает инциденты по временным отрезкам или числу строк. Платформа сохраняет сведения в протяжение определённого периода, после производит агрегацию и вычисление показателей. Периоды могут быть неподвижными, динамичными или сеансовыми в зависимости от логики сервиса.
Обработка с сохранением состояния поддерживает связь между событиями. Система фиксирует промежуточные результаты, счётчики, аккумулированные значения для будущих вычислений. 1иксбет использует децентрализованное базу для достижения согласованности. Вариант без статуса обслуживает события автономно, что улучшает увеличение.
Размещение данных: горячие (real-time) и долгосрочные (архивные) ярусы
Построение хранения данных в платформах реального времени разделяется на несколько слоев в зависимости от частоты доступа и запросов к темпу получения. Такое сегментация оптимизирует расходы и обеспечивает соотношение между производительностью и расходами.
Оперативный слой хранит текущие данные, к которым нужен быстрый обращение. Информация помещается в рабочей ОЗУ или на производительных SSD-дисках для уменьшения времени ответа. Хранилища этого яруса обслуживают тысячи запросов в секунду. Срок хранения составляет от нескольких часов до нескольких дней.
Тёплый слой сохраняет данные среднего периода для исследования и формирования отчетов. Инциденты мигрируют сюда самостоятельно после завершения времени релевантности. 1хбет казино предоставляет равновесие между скоростью запроса и количеством размещения.
Архивный архивный слой служит для долгосрочного размещения исторических сведений. Сведения хранится на дешевых устройствах с низкоскоростным чтением. Репозитории задействуются для выполнения нормам регуляторов, проверки и исследования паттернов. Период размещения может доходить нескольких лет.
Расширение и устойчивость
Способность комплекса обслуживать растущие объёмы данных и поддерживать функциональность при отказах определяет её стабильность в производственной среде. Архитектура должна включать инструменты горизонтального роста и дублирования существенных частей.
Горизонтальное увеличение внедряет новые серверы обработки при увеличении трафика. Инциденты автоматом делятся между свободными серверами в соответствии алгоритмам балансировки. Система активно адаптируется к корректировке потока данных без паузы.
Механизмы достижения устойчивости 1xbet казино содержат:
- Дублирование данных между серверами для предупреждения исчезновений
- Самостоятельное переключение на резервные части при аварии
- Контрольные метки для сохранения состояния обслуживания
- Восстановление с продолжением с финального сохранённого положения
Распределение нагрузки выполняется на основе ключей партиционирования, которые задают распределение происшествий к обработчикам. 1иксбет гарантирует упорядоченную преобразование взаимосвязанных инцидентов на единственном узле. Наблюдение работоспособности серверов обеспечивает определять деградацию скорости и переназначать функции.
Отслеживание и алертинг: как наблюдают состояние потоков и отвечают на нарушения
Постоянное наблюдение за состоянием системы обработки событий обеспечивает находить проблемы до их серьезного влияния на бизнес-процессы. Средства отслеживания накапливают показатели эффективности и формируют оповещения при отклонениях от обычных величин.
Важнейшие метрики охватывают интенсивность поступления инцидентов, отсрочку обработки, длину очередей и количество ошибок. Платформы наблюдают нагрузку вычислителей, эксплуатацию памяти и дискового пространства на узлах кластера. Диаграммы демонстрируют изменение параметров в реальном времени.
Граничные параметры задают пределы обычного действия для каждой показателя. При превышении лимитов система автоматически производит предупреждения для администраторов. 1хбет казино дает устанавливать нормы оповещения с рассмотрением критичности многообразных классов инцидентов.
Изучение нарушений применяет статистические приемы для определения аномальных закономерностей в потоках данных. Методы определяют внезапные пики загрузки, нестандартные серии инцидентов, сомнительную деятельность. Самостоятельные действия содержат масштабирование мощностей, переключение на запасные потоки или ограничение входящего нагрузки.
Иллюстрации задействования механизмов обработки происшествий
Экономические учреждения эксплуатируют системы обработки происшествий для определения поддельных переводов. Алгоритмы исследуют каждую транзакцию по карте в момент проведения, сопоставляя с предыдущими образцами поведения клиента. При определении сомнительной поведения механизм прерывает операцию за миллисекунды.
Онлайн-магазины задействуют поточную преобразование для персонализации советов товаров. Инциденты обзора страниц, добавления в тележку и покупок преобразуются в реальном времени. Платформа генерирует релевантные рекомендации на фундаменте мгновенного действий посетителя.
Индустриальные компании применяют контроль устройств для предиктивного обслуживания. Датчики на промышленных конвейерах передают величины колебаний, температуры и энергопотребления. 1иксбет исследует данные и прогнозирует потенциальные поломки, что дает проектировать восстановление без незапланированных прерываний.
Транспортные фирмы отслеживают движение посылок и улучшают пути перевозки. GPS-трекеры генерируют позиции автомобильных средств каждые несколько секунд. Механизм рассматривает затруднения и приоритетность отправлений для оперативной корректировки путей и уведомления заказчиков о времени прибытия.
